Details
A vulnerability was found in Affordable Web Space Design WebBBS up to 5.0. It has been classified as very critical. This affects an unknown function of the file webbbs_post.pl. The manipulation of the argument followup with an unknown input leads to a privileges management vulnerability. CWE is classifying the issue as CWE-269. The product does not properly assign, modify, track, or check privileges for an actor, creating an unintended sphere of control for that actor. This is going to have an impact on confidentiality, integrity, and availability. The summary by CVE is:
webbbs_post.pl in WebBBS 4 and 5.0 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ary commands via shell metacharacters in the followup parameter.
The bug was discovered 06/18/2002. The weakness was published 12/31/2002 by ViPeR (Website). It is possible to read the advisory at securityfocus.com. This vulnerability is uniquely identified as CVE-2002-1993 since 07/14/2005. The exploitability is told to be easy. It is possible to initiate the attack remotely. No form of authentication is needed for exploitation. Technical details and a public exploit are known. The pricing for an exploit might be around USD $0-$5k at the moment (estimation calculated on 08/31/2025). The attack technique deployed by this issue is T1068 according to MITRE ATT&CK.
A public exploit has been developed in Perl. The exploit is shared for download at securityfocus.com. It is declared as proof-of-concept. The vulnerability was handled as a non-public zero-day exploit for at least 196 days. During that time the estimated underground price was around $0-$5k. The commercial vulnerability scanner Qualys is able to test this issue with plugin 10879 (WebScripts WebBBS Remote Command Execution Vulnerability).
There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product. Furthermore it is possible to detect and prevent this kind of attack with TippingPoint and the filter 9904.
